Granada
Granada

Post breakfast, check out from your hotel and head east toward Granada. A large array of olive trees welcome you as you reach the heart of Andalusia. Granada is popular for the last stronghold of the Moorish Kingdoms up to 1492. Visit the world famous Alhambra complex and Generalife Gardens that have inspired several authors with its sound and sights, such as the ?Tales of the Alhambra?.


Day

6

Valencia
Valencia Spain

Head northeast as you drive across Segura river, continuing north via Alicante, the second largest city within the region of Valencia. Located on the Mediterranean coast, Valencia?s Arts and Sciences Architectural Complex is integrated by six elements: Hemispheric, Umbracle, Science Museum, Oceanographic, Palau de les Arts and ?gora. Valencia is also the home of the internationally well renowned and delicious ?Paella?.

You can also take a boat to Ibiza from here, the party haven of the world.
